Centre’s Pact with Tripura and Key Demands of Greater Tipraland

Context: A tripartite agreement was signed between the Centre, the Tripura government, and TIPRA Motha, aiming for a “honourable resolution” of tribal demands in Tripura.

Key Demands of Centre’s Pact with Tripura

  • Creation of “Greater Tipraland,” a separate state for Tripura’s tribal population, including enhancements to the Tripura Tribal Areas Autonomous District Council (TTAADC).
  • Requests for TTAADC include direct funding from the Centre, its own police force, and revenue sharing from state gas exploration.
  • They also seek official status for the Roman script for Kokborok language.

Accord Details

  • The accord pledges to address indigenous issues related to history, land, political rights, economic development, identity, culture, and language in Tripura.
  • A joint working group/committee will be formed to expedite and implement agreed points for a respectful solution.
  • Stakeholders agreed to avoid protests/agitations from the agreement’s signing day to foster a positive implementation environment.
